China always trustworthy, reliable strategic partner for Thailand: Xi

2026-07-17 21:42 Last Updated At:23:47

China has always been a trustworthy and reliable strategic partner for Thailand, said Chinese President Xi Jinping on Friday in Shanghai during a meeting with Thai Prime Minister Anutin Charnvirakul.

Anutin is in China to attend the 2026 World AI Conference and High-Level Meeting on Global AI Governance in Shanghai and on an official visit to China.

"The China-Thailand friendship, which has endured for over a millennium, has only grown stronger with the passage of time. We have treated each other with sincerity and forged a bond of mutual trust, giving rise to the cherished sentiment that 'China and Thailand are one family.' China places the development of China-Thailand relations in an important position in its neighborhood diplomacy and has always been a reliable and trustworthy strategic cooperative partner for Thailand. Going forward, both sides should further enhance strategic mutual trust, strengthen strategic coordination, and jointly address challenges, so as to accelerate the building of a more stable, prosperous and sustainable China-Thailand community with a shared future to contribute to peace, stability, development and prosperity in the region," Xi said.

For his part, Anutin said, "I am honored to be back in China on my first official visit as prime minister. Thailand always views China as an old and reliable friend. We welcome all your four global initiatives because they reflect our commitment to multilateralism and a multilateral world order based on international law. AI will transform our economies and societies. Thailand and China can work together to unlock this new engine of growth."

Chinese President Xi Jinping on Friday urged efforts to carry out search and rescue operations in a scientific manner after a landslide struck a county in southwest China's Chongqing Municipality, leaving people trapped and missing.

The landslide occurred at 9:08 Friday in Hanjia Sub-district along a section of the Wujiang River in Pengshui Miao and Tujia Autonomous County, burying several residential buildings at the foot of the mountain. Ten people had been rescued as of 14:00, according to local authorities.

In his instructions, Xi stressed the need for scientific search and rescue operations to prevent secondary disasters, and called for proper medical treatment for the injured and appropriate arrangements for the aftermath. He also urged relevant departments to identify the cause of the disaster, draw lessons from this case and conduct thorough inspections to eliminate geological hazards. Xi emphasized that all regions and relevant departments must further fulfill their safety responsibilities, strengthen monitoring, early warning and risk inspection systems, and ensure that all work is carried out in a concrete and meticulous manner, so as to effectively protect the lives and property of the people.

The Ministry of Natural Resources on Friday raised its geological disaster emergency response to Level II from Level III and dispatched a working team to the site.

A four-tier emergency response system is in place for geological disasters, with Level I being the most severe.
